The tricuspid valve prevents the backflow of blood to the right atrium..The tricuspid valve separates the right atrium from the right ventricle. It opens to allow the de-oxygenated blood collected in the right atrium to flow into the right ventricle. It closes as the right ventricle contracts, preventing blood from returning to the right atrium; thereby, forcing it to exit through the pulmonary valve into the pulmonary artery.

Tricuspid valve (located between the Rigth Atrium and Right Ventricle in the heart) is also known as the Right Atrioventricular valve. The name "Tricuspid" indicates its structure, or form, as it has three flaps (or cusps), against the Bicuspid Valve (located between the Left Atrium and the Left Ventricle), which only has two.
